Runbook: Wrenhollow nightly reindex. The search reindex runs at 02:00 under the svc-reindex account. If that account locks after failed logins, recovery is self-service via the indexer console — no ticket needed. Verify the last successful run timestamp before restarting. To complete account recovery, enter the recovery passphrase below.

strongbox words: wenix-ulador

Subject: Log sampling cut-over done

For the sync: Chattervane's log sampling cut over last night. Volume down 88%, error-level lines still unsampled, trace IDs preserved for correlation. Ingest costs should drop visibly by Friday. One hiccup — the canary briefly double-sampled debug lines; fixed before full rollout. Dashboards updated. No action needed from other teams. Current sampler settings, now live across all regions, are as follows.

service settings:
novath:
  pin: 1396
  tenant: pelys
  seal: seal_ccc035e1
  metrics_host: metrics.novath.qorvelworks.test
  standby_team: fraeth
  escalation: drueth-zorok
  nonce: 61d508

## Planner Regression: Quilldex 4.2

Since the Quilldex 4.2 rollout, join reordering favors nested loops on mid-cardinality tables, inflating p95 latency on the Ostermere cluster by roughly 18%. We traced this to stale selectivity defaults rather than statistics drift. Mira proposes pinning the following constants until the estimator fix lands. The current values are:

tuning table, yajog-yahof:
BUDGETS = {
    "lamvan": 303,
    "wenox": 460,
    "fenvan": 525,
}

Release runbook — BounceHarbor processor, v3.2. Before promoting the new bounce classifier, drain the retry queue and confirm no messages older than 15 minutes remain. Verify the suppression-list snapshot completed, then tag the release candidate. The artifact must be signed prior to upload; the Quillgate pipeline will refuse an unsigned build and page you again. Use the on-call signing key, rotated last Tuesday, which is provided here.

rollout seal: bky4_x7Gc

Welcome to the Plumefan notification service. Fan-out workers apply backpressure when the Driftwell broker queue exceeds its high-water mark; producers block rather than drop. Never raise the watermark without sign-off from the platform lead. To deploy worker changes you must sign the release manifest. The key used to sign Plumefan manifests appears directly below this line.

release key, kawif-hawep: bky13_X7TGuRG4Zu4ZJ